What’s Missing in Today’s AI Tools
Many smartphone users find themselves frustrated with AI tools that seem more intrusive than helpful. Features such as AI-generated images and text, while novel, are often plagued by issues like stereotypes and inaccuracies. Furthermore, AI's reliance on cloud computing can drain device power with minimal tangible benefits. This prompts a critical question for many: are these tools truly solving any significant problems or simply creating new ones?
